CVE-2017-13860: Medium severity macos high sierra vulnerability

An issue was discovered in certain Apple products. iOS before 11.2 is affected. macOS before 10.13.2 is affected. The issue involves the "Mail Drafts" component. It allows man-in-the-middle attackers to read e-mail content by leveraging mishandling of S/MIME credential encryption.

Other sources

Mail Drafts. An encryption issue existed with S/MIME credentials. The issue was addressed with additional checks and user control.
